Fantastic performance from us. Dominated for majority of the match and looked solid defensively when Leicester attacked us.

Chalobae with the fantastic assist. He's a good passer of the ball and wouldn't look out of place starting for us imo. He could be the one that finally makes it from the youth team. :)

When costa plays well, Chelsea play well. I remember that season we bought him, where he was scoring almost every game, we played our best football for half a season. Costa is looking as good as that once again.

Hazard looks involved more centrally, please let it stay that way.

 Kante along with costa is our best player. Sometimes he was giving passes like Pirlo, if he knew how to shoot he'll be one of the best midfielders in world football, has everything else in his locker.

Luiz has been fantastic, he's thriving in the Bonucci role and I hope he stays there permanently. 

Moses is all energy, all action, causes trouble out wide always. Well done 

Alonso was fantastic in the first half. It feels so good having a left-footed leftback that can cross once again. Looks a huge threat in attack. 

Matic was very good, didn’t dwell on the ball and passed out quickly. 

Pedro was energetic, huge contribution in the link up play but lack of quality up top.

Azpi and cahill have been steady in this formation. It'll be sad if Azpi gets dropped for Terry :(

Conte has got us playing quicker in the attacking third of the pitch, quick one twos between the 3 upfront. We also look more comfortable sitting deep with this 3-4-3 compared to the 4-1-4-1 Courtois has had nothing to do since we went 3 at the back. And he trusts youth, I think he likes chalobah. 10/10 from Conte today.

No hate, but Im just wondering whats this trend with Kante and "if he could shoot he would be best midfielder"? I have seen it in few posts now. 

I mean, he is DM/box to box and his role is to break up play and connect both ends. He does that absolutely brilliantly. Last season he was best PL midfielder. 

I just wonder why is everything in football being best connected with goals. Strikers obviously. But Kante? Its almost like saying; if only Bonucci could shoot he would be best CB in the world :)

Kante is what he is and he is doing bloody brilliant in that role. His job was never to score goals, I dont think why would that make him best midfielder if he already is "best" at what he does. 

For midfielders, goals are far too valued today. Pogba got half of the fame for his shooting ability, while there are many things he needs to improve.

Obviously finishing would make Kante even more complete, but for me he is player who breaks up attacks and sets them up, not finishes them. As long he does that he will be best in his role, regardless of how many or how little he scores.
